Why would I see this? Well there's no way it could possibly be as bad as the first one. And it's not. It's definitely not great but you could do worse. Where else are you gonna see The Rock sing a song while playing the ukulele or Michael Caine riding a giant bee?

The only holdovers from the first instalment I can see are Josh Hutcherson, the pretty cool score by Andrew Lockington and the bastardisation of another beloved Jules Verne novel. They do get away with it somewhat by treating the novel as a treasure map within the story, just like the first. They also throw in some 20 000 leagues for good measure and set up a trilogy capper with from the Earth to the Moon.

First off, I'm gonna say, the 3D is great and the Fx are way better this time around. I don't like what I hear about the poor fx houses getting cheated out of wages in the first instalment but I still didn't care for their work. Thing look pretty good this time and there a range of creatures and incredible vistas keeping things looking very pretty.

Once again the 3D is abused for many gimmicky tricks in the name of fun. I didn't mind so much though.

Luis Guzmán doesn't fare to well in this but the rest of the cast were fine, even Vanessa Hudgens.

I'll probably never see this again but it's not too horrific and definitely a step up from part 1.
